How do I write a recommendation for a manager on LinkedIn?
- Explain the nature of your professional relationship.
- Provide details of the position for which you're recommending the person.
- Explain how they've grown at the company.
- Indicate how their contribution helped grow the team or company.
- Explain what these achievements reveal about that person.

Moreover, how do you write a letter of recommendation for a manager?
Structure, Content and Flow. Your recommendation letter should be approximately three paragraphs. The first paragraph should explain your relationship to your boss, how long she has been your boss and the reason you're writing on her behalf.
Secondly, how do I recommend someone to my boss? Write a letter for your friend to attach to his application and suggest he mention your name and recommendation in his cover letter. In a small company, talk to the boss personally to say you'd like to make a recommendation via a personal introduction. An informal coffee or lunch meeting can get the ball rolling.
Besides, how do you write a recommendation?
Tips on Writing Personal Recommendation Letters
- Think carefully before saying yes.
- Follow a business letter format.
- Focus on the job description.
- Explain how you know the person, and for how long.
- Focus on one or two traits.
- Remain positive.
- Share your contact information.
- Follow the submission guidelines.

How do you write a short letter of recommendation?
FAQs:- State that you're offering your recommendation.
- State what you're recommending the person for.
- State the nature of your relationship (supervisor, teacher, etc).
- State the length of time you have known this person.
- List a description of the traits that make the person recommendable.
Who writes a letter of recommendation?
A recommendation letter is written by a previous employer, colleague, client, teacher, or by someone else who can recommend an individual's work or academic performance. Can a friend write a letter of recommendation for a job?
A letter of recommendation for a friend, also called a personal reference or a character reference, summarizes your personal experience with the characteristics and skills that qualify them for the position. Personal reference letters are common additions to applications for candidates who are seeking their first jobs.How do you ask someone for a job via email?
